Why Pineapple Banana Smoothie Weight Loss Works

Detailed infographic showing weight loss benefits of pineapple banana smoothie ingredients, split-screen layout with fresh pineapple chunks

The science behind this tropical combo is pretty straightforward. Pineapples contain bromelain, a natural enzyme that helps break down proteins and supports healthy digestion. Better digestion often means less bloating and more efficient nutrient absorption.

Bananas bring potassium and fiber to the party. That fiber helps you feel full longer, which naturally reduces snacking between meals. Plus, the natural sweetness satisfies sugar cravings without reaching for processed treats.

Here’s how it works: when you start your day with a fiber-rich smoothie, your blood sugar stays more stable. No dramatic spikes and crashes that leave you hunting for snacks an hour later.

The Metabolism Connection

Both fruits support healthy metabolism in different ways:

• Pineapple provides vitamin C and manganese for energy production
• Bananas offer B-vitamins that help convert food into fuel
• Natural fruit sugars give quick energy for morning workouts
• Fiber content requires energy to digest, slightly boosting calorie burn

This combination creates a gentle, sustainable approach to weight management. No extreme restrictions or complicated meal plans – just real food that tastes great.

Essential Ingredients for Pineapple Banana Smoothie Weight Loss

Let’s keep it simple with five basic ingredients that deliver maximum impact. You don’t need fancy superfoods or expensive supplements – these everyday items work perfectly.

The Core Recipe

1. Fresh or Frozen Pineapple (1 cup)
Choose chunks over juice for maximum fiber. Frozen works great and keeps the smoothie thick and cold.

2. Ripe Banana (1 medium)
The riper, the sweeter. Brown spots are your friend here – they mean natural sugars are at their peak.

3. Greek Yogurt (½ cup)
Adds protein to keep you satisfied longer. Plain variety keeps sugar content lower.

4. Coconut Water (½ cup)
Natural electrolytes and subtle sweetness. Regular water works too if budget is tight.

5. Fresh Spinach (1 handful)
Sounds weird, tastes invisible. Adds vitamins and minerals without changing the tropical flavor.

Smart Substitutions

Tight budget? Swap coconut water for regular water and add a pinch of salt.

No Greek yogurt? Try cottage cheese or silken tofu for protein.

Spinach too expensive? Skip it entirely – the smoothie still works great.

Banana allergy? Use frozen mango or half an avocado for creaminess.

Step-by-Step Pineapple Banana Smoothie Weight Loss Recipe

This comes together fast – we’re talking two minutes from start to finish. Perfect for rushed mornings or quick post-workout fuel.

Preparation Steps

Step 1: Add liquids first
Pour coconut water into blender. This prevents ingredients from sticking to the bottom.

Step 2: Add soft ingredients
Drop in banana pieces and yogurt. Break banana into chunks for easier blending.

Step 3: Add frozen fruit
Toss in pineapple chunks. Frozen fruit creates that thick, milkshake-like texture.

Step 4: Sneak in the greens
Add spinach last. It blends better when it’s on top of other ingredients.

Step 5: Blend and adjust
Start on low speed, then increase. Blend 30-60 seconds until smooth. Add more liquid if too thick.

Pro Tips for Perfect Results

• Freeze ripe bananas when they get spotty – perfect smoothie texture
• Buy pineapple in bulk when on sale and freeze in portions
• Prep smoothie packs on Sunday – portion ingredients in freezer bags
• Start with less liquid – easier to thin than thicken
• Taste before serving – adjust sweetness with extra banana if needed

The beauty of this recipe is its flexibility. Some days you might want it thicker, other days more liquid. Trust your taste buds and adjust accordingly.

Maximizing Weight Loss Benefits

A pineapple banana smoothie for weight loss works best as part of a balanced approach. Here’s how to get the most from this tropical treat.

Timing Matters

Morning fuel: Replace sugary breakfast cereals with this smoothie. The fiber and protein keep energy steady until lunch.

Pre-workout boost: Drink 30 minutes before exercise for natural energy without stomach upset.

Post-workout recovery: Add an extra scoop of protein powder to support muscle recovery.

Afternoon snack: When 3 PM cravings hit, this beats vending machine options every time.

Portion Control Strategy

One smoothie typically contains 200-300 calories, depending on ingredients. That’s perfect for:

• Breakfast replacement with a piece of whole grain toast
• Snack between meals when hunger strikes
• Light lunch paired with a small salad
• Dessert alternative that actually nourishes your body

Enhancing the Formula

Add healthy fats: A tablespoon of almond butter or chia seeds increases satiety.

Boost protein: Extra Greek yogurt or protein powder helps maintain muscle during weight loss.

Increase fiber: Ground flaxseed or psyllium husk powder adds filling power.

Spice it up: Cinnamon may help regulate blood sugar naturally.

Remember, sustainable weight loss happens gradually. This smoothie supports your goals by providing nutrients and satisfaction – not by creating dramatic, unsustainable restrictions.

Even simple recipes can go wrong. Here are the most common pineapple banana smoothie weight loss mistakes and easy fixes.

Texture Troubles

Problem: Smoothie turns out watery and thin
Solution: Use frozen fruit instead of fresh, or add less liquid initially

Problem: Too thick to drink comfortably
Solution: Add liquid gradually while blending – start with 2 tablespoons at a time

Problem: Chunks of fruit remain after blending
Solution: Blend longer, or cut fruit into smaller pieces before adding

Flavor Issues

Problem: Not sweet enough without added sugar
Solution: Use very ripe bananas, or add a few dates for natural sweetness

Problem: Too tart from pineapple
Solution: Reduce pineapple by half and add extra banana for balance

Problem: Can taste the spinach
Solution: Start with just a few leaves and gradually increase over time

Practical Problems

Problem: Smoothie separates quickly after blending
Solution: This is normal – just stir before drinking, or add a small amount of xanthan gum

Problem: Too expensive to make regularly
Solution: Buy frozen fruit in bulk, use regular water instead of coconut water, skip expensive add-ins

Problem: Gets boring after a few days
Solution: Rotate different greens, try mint or ginger, add different spices like cinnamon or vanilla

The key is starting simple and adjusting based on your preferences. Don’t try to perfect everything on the first attempt.

Meal Prep and Storage Tips

Making pineapple banana smoothie weight loss part of your routine gets easier with smart prep strategies. Here’s how to streamline the process.

Batch Preparation Methods

Smoothie Freezer Packs
Portion all ingredients except liquid into freezer bags. Label with date and instructions. Just dump, add liquid, and blend.

Pre-Cut Fruit Storage
Wash and chop pineapple on Sunday. Store in glass containers for up to 5 days. Peel and slice bananas, then freeze in single layers.

Yogurt Ice Cubes
Freeze Greek yogurt in ice cube trays. Pop out 2-3 cubes per smoothie for perfect portions and extra thickness.

Storage Solutions

Fresh smoothies last 24 hours in the refrigerator. Store in glass jars or bottles with tight lids.

Separation is normal – just shake or stir before drinking. The fiber and pulp naturally settle.

Freezing prepared smoothies works for up to 3 months. Thaw overnight in the fridge, then blend briefly to restore texture.

Time-Saving Strategies

• Prep ingredients Sunday night for the entire week
• Keep frozen fruit stocked so fresh fruit ripeness doesn’t matter
• Use pre-washed spinach to skip washing and chopping
• Invest in a good blender that handles frozen fruit easily
• Make double batches when you have extra time

Smart prep means healthy choices become the easy choice, even on busy mornings.
